Application Engineer – Power Solutions

Salary: £43,000 – £50,000

Working Hours: 08:45 – 17:00 with travelling involved

Scania GB are looking to fill an exciting opportunity as Application Engineer. Within this role you will primarily be responsible for advising customers about the installation of Scania engines, within the Construction, Marine, Agriculture and Genset sectors.

Daily, this means you will work with our new and existing strategic customers in their switch for future products in their development projects.

Key Responsibilities:

  • To advise customers on the installation of Scania engines within a wide range of application equipment, according to Scania installation recommendations, including Marine, Power-Gen, and Construction.
  • Undertake customer site testing using electronic data logging equipment.
  • Complete Scania installation review reports and communicate any deviations to the customer.
  • Provide the required technical documentation, to support the Engines Sales team when preparing tenders and quotations.
  • Supply customers with technical drawings, and installation information as required.
  • Assist the Sales team in providing complete engineering solutions.
  • Liaise with Scania Technical departments (Scania Great Britain and Sweden) and assist with applications-related items as and when required.
  • Coordinate the modification of the engines to meet the customer’s specifications.
  • Comply with company Safety, Health, and Environmental policies at all times, including the mandatory wearing of personal protective equipment and machine guarding.
